When the man saw Gu Chengyu’s sword coming towards him, he immediately swung out his short knife to block. Unfortunately, he didn’t anticipate that Gu Chengyu’s move was merely a feint.
Gu Chengyu quickly retracted his sword and stabbed towards his chest. The man wanted to block but it was too late. His chest was pierced through, and he fell back into the river behind him.
With just one encounter, Gu Chengyu killed a river bandit. This completely enraged them. Several of them quickly surrounded Gu Chengyu and charged at him together.
Gu Chengyu utilized his energy to defend himself, moving swiftly, and wove his sword in a dome of steel around himself, impenetrable.
Then, as they retracted their hands to come again, he seized the opportunity, executing a horizontal slash. The sword swept across two men on his left side, instantly taking them down.
Before they could react, he mustered his Qinggong, moving behind them, and thrust his sword into the chest of the man on the right.
Simultaneously, he channeled his Inner Strength, delivering a palm strike to the person in front of him. This person flew backwards, crashing into the ship’s railing, a mouthful of blood spurting out.
Gu Chengyu’s speed was astonishingly fast, they hadn’t anticipated it at all. Of the six that approached, four were already dead.
Inside a room on the ship, a man in his forties was pacing back and forth.
"Master! The situation outside is becoming dire!" At this moment, a man dressed as a servant entered from outside, speaking to the person inside the room.
"What’s happening? Can those sailors and guards hold them off?" The man referred to as Master hurriedly stepped forward to inquire.
"I’ve scouted; the sailors and guards are not up to the task. However, there is one person who is very formidable, leading their subordinates to withstand them!"
The Master grew more anxious; he initially thought those people came because of him. But now it seemed otherwise. He calmed down, "Hui An! Go out and assist!"
"Master! If I go out, who will protect you?" Hui An was only responsible for the Master’s safety, he couldn’t manage others.
"We are all on this ship, and this is the middle of the river, even if we want to shore it’s not possible. If the river bandits seize the ship, we can’t escape either, so go!"
Hu Maoshen thought of many things. This time he came out was due to secret orders, could it be that the news had leaked? The Jingyuan River bandits usually ignore passenger ships, as long as the ship pays the toll in silver, there’s peace. But why violate this rule this time?
The government always wanted to clean up the river bandits, but they were extremely cunning. Who knows where they hide on ordinary days? All ships look about the same with no distinctive marks. Who would think it a pirate ship?
Hu Maoshen thought more and more, perhaps they came for him. Besides, with so many civilians on the ship, he couldn’t just watch them walk to their deaths. Besides, as an official, if he survived today and hid on the ship without moving, he’d be despised by colleagues in the court.
"Then be careful, Master, I will go help!" Hui An of course knew this was the right thing to do; the more people, the better the odds. The river bandits were just a band of mob. If he joined forces with a few skilled individuals, they had a good chance to protect the civilians on board.
"They’ve set up boarding planks, they’re coming over." People on the ship began to exclaim.
Gu Chengyu quickly dispatched two more people, and upon turning back, saw that indeed the pirate ship was some distance away, but the hull was sinking.
Yet, they had set up boarding planks, and others were assisting along the ship’s searail. Therefore, no one noticed when they ran over along the planks.
When Gu Chengyu looked, three or four people had already come over, and people at the ship’s searail were struggling to hold on, truly a situation of being attacked from both sides.
Uncle Li ran to the deck, finding everything in chaos outside with plenty of bloodstains on the ship, his heart sank, realizing the battle had started.
Just as he wanted to step forward and assist, he heard someone shout that the river bandits had come over on boarding planks. He wanted to advance and stop them but found he was empty-handed without a knife.
After dealing with a few people, Gu Chengyu couldn’t pay attention to those at the searail anymore. There were more bandits on that ship. If they all came over and scattered, even if he fought with all his might, it would be too late.
Gu Chengyu leapt forward, seeing a burly man beside him. Gu Chengyu became cautious, could this be another insider?
"Throw me a knife!" Uncle Li had learned hard martial arts, not Qinggong, picking up a knife by running would definitely take time.
Seeing that Uncle Li didn’t seem like a river bandit, Ming Mo threw a knife over.
Gu Chengyu’s treasure sword was extraordinarily sharp, would cut through even a hair without hindrance. As long as he cut the plank, those people would only swim over.
Gu Chengyu dealt with two entangled opponents, and with a slashing motion, the plank broke with a snap, and the river bandits walking on the plank fell into the river.
But they were not afraid, every river bandit was a swimmer, as long as they swam aboard, it would be fine.
Uncle Li, having gotten a knife, joined the fray. The two of them together resolved the people who ran over on the plank, but Uncle Li received a stab on his arm.
The bandit leader on the opposite ship was a one-eyed dragon, known as Half-blind Wang. He looked at Gu Chengyu wielding a sword on the opposite ship, utterly furious.
They initially planned to launch a surprise attack in the dark, since the ship had their insiders. Also summoning a few with special swimming skills to stealthily board the ship, but unexpectedly, before their ship got close, they were discovered by the other side. Moreover, the other side took preemptive action, catching them off guard. They’d lost a ship this time, he must reclaim the loss later.
This young boy, so ruthless in his moves, wielded his sword so quickly; every strike meant life or death for someone. Damn, the insiders on the ship hadn’t informed them of this personality, they didn’t know such a person was on board.
The ship underfoot had sunk more than half. Half-blind Wang yelled, "Everyone into the water! Get on their ship!"
After saying so, he himself jumped into the river first. Subsequently, the river bandits on the ship all followed and jumped down.
Gu Chengyu had already seen the Half-blind Wang standing on the ship, seeing his aura seemed kind of like a bandit leader. He hurriedly rushed beside, intending to take a bow and capture the leader first as the saying goes; everyone knows the reason. As long as they shot dead the bandit leader, the rest were no longer a threat.
But this Half-blind Wang was very cautious. At the beginning, he was stationed behind the ship’s board and then jumped into the river. In the water, finding their traces became very difficult.
The remaining bandits on the opposite ship, like dumplings, all jumped down. Gu Chengyu specially noted down, discovering there were eight in total.
Holding the bow, Gu Chengyu looked towards the place the bandit leader jumped and guessed his trajectory, searching his figure in the river.
This later batch of river bandits was indeed seasoned, Gu Chengyu had yet to spot even a shadow, surprisingly they all dove so deep. He focused, not blinking, watching the water’s movements. He believed the bandit leader had likely noticed him, thinking maybe they intended to deal with him first.
Uncle Li had already gone to the ship’s rail to help. His fighting prowess was indeed fierce. Though his arm was injured, when he wielded the sword, it still struck with formidable force.
Gu Chengyu spared a glance; this person was indeed capable, also an effective helper.
